mercoledì 26 agosto 2020

Compilare Fritzing da sorgenti su Debian

Ho appena scoperto che non e' piu' possibile scaricare in modo gratuito Fritzing....ma e' comunque possibile compilarlo da sorgenti

Ovviamente ho deciso di provare a compilarlo da sorgenti


Per prima cosa si deve creare un directory in cui eseguire


git clone https://github.com/fritzing/fritzing-app

git clone https://github.com/fritzing/fritzing-parts


a questo punto si scaricano i sorgenti di Boost

apt-get install  libboost-dev

si crea quindi una directory libgit2 e si decomprimono i sorgenti da https://github.com/libgit2/libgit2/releases/tag/v0.28.5 e si compilano

mkdir build 
cd build 
cmake -DBUILD_SHARED_LIBS=OFF .. 
cmake --build .

a questo punto si apre QtCreator e si apre il progetto phoenix.pro e si lancia la compilazione

Arrivati fino a qui l'eseguibile e' compilato ma non riesce a trovare le librerie delle parti elettroniche

Per attivarle da linea di comando si lancia

/Fritzing -f "/home/luca/fritzing/build-phoenix-Desktop_Qt_5_13_2_GCC_64bit-Debug/" -parts "/home/luca/fritzing/fritzing-parts/"




Nessun commento:

Posta un commento

Debugger integrato ESP32S3

Aggiornamento In realta' il Jtag USB funziona anche sui moduli cinesi Il problema risiede  nell'ID USB della porta Jtag. Nel modulo...